html5做手机app开发

HTML5已经成为现在手机app开发领域的一个热门技术。当谈及HTML5手机app开发时,HTML5实际上只是一个客户端技术,建立在现有的HTML和JavaScript技术基础之上。实现HTML5手机app开发的首选框架是jQuery Mobile框架,但是需要注意的是,由于大量使用JavaScript,app在性能和动画效果上可能存在一定的问题。

一、HTML5手机app开发的优点

HTML5手机app开发的优点包括兼容性好(支持多种移动端和桌面端平台)、开发成本低(使用一致的代码库)、数据同步(通过缺省的web协议和技术,轻松同步数据)、扩展性(融合了现有的互联网标准和开放的技术,包括社交网络、位置服务和支付系统等)、易于维护(使用一致的代码库)等。

二、开发一个HTML5手机app的步骤:

1. 设计界面

2. 使用HTML、CSS和JavaScript来创建用户界面

3. 使用相应的API或第三方工具将数据与应用程序建立联系

4. 测试应用程序并修复错误

5. 导出并发布应用程序

三、HTML5手机app开发的应用场景

HTML5手机app开发的应用场景包括社交网络、移动支付、门户站点、企业资源管理、移动商店、多次录制、在线教育、移动游戏等等。HTML5手机app的应用场景与桌面端应用已经逐渐趋同,而且随着技术的不断升级,HTML5的应用领域也正在不断扩大。

四、目前HTML5手机app开发面临的挑战

HTML5手机app在许多方面与原生应用相比,性能相对较弱。因此,要在质量,安全性,性能和可扩展性上发行HTML5应用程序并让其成功,开发人员必须注意以下几点:

1. 使用专业开发工具和开发框架来提高开发效率和性能;

2. 遵循W3C的标准,并且及时升级HTML5的技术,并进行适度的测试;

3. 在设计过程中将移动设备的特定需求考虑在内;

4. 掌握桌面端和移动端的编程技术,避免在过于复杂的场景中进行HTML5应用程序开发。

总之,HTML5技术在手机app开发领域中的应用仍有很大的探索空间,随着技术和开发工具的不断升级,未来HTML5手机app开发的发展前景一片光明。